The York Regional Police said a man in his twenties is in critical condition after being shot in Vaughan early Saturday morning. Officers responded to a shooting in the area of Highway 7 and Exchange Road around 3:30 a.m., and upon arrival, officers found a man in a parking lot with gunshot wounds. He was taken to the hospital with serious injuries where he underwent surgery this morning. The police also stated that although this is not a homicide, the homicide unit took over due to the nature of the situation as there were several potential witnesses in the area, who investigators urged to come forward with their testimonies.
